A few years back I installed a used florescent light fixture in my garage. The light fixture had four t10 tubes and two ballasts.

The light worked great during the summer months. But if it rained or was humid, or during the winter months getting the light to turn on was nearly impossible. Very frustrating when you need to get something fixed or want to work on a project but can't.

I could have replaced the ballast and bulbs and solve the problem. Then there was also the annoying constant hum....

Anyways I bought two (HTlights t8 LED's 4000K 18W Tubes) of these lights and 4 tombstones. I removed the old ballasts and cut the wires off of them to wire the LED's up to the new tombstones. My package did not come with instructions but after a little searching online the installation was easy. You only have to wire up one side of the fixture (i.e. each tube has a positive and negative on each side), you only have to connect + and - on one side, the other side does not need to be connected to anything. The old tombstones can be used to hold the light in place on that other side of the tube, just cut and remove the wiring from them.

After I was all done I pushed the breaker back in, flipped the switch and was instantly surprised at the light output. These lights are much easier to see with because they are white. They make things look clearer and better if you ask me. Not only that but there is no more annoying hum, and the lights turn on instantly regardless of the temperature or humidity in the garage.

Now that I know what these lights look like I just bought two more to complete the fixture.
I would say the lights are just as bright as the 36W t10's they replaced but they put out a whiter, clearer light that is much better to work with. Great for the garage and shop!
